Despite a common misconception, carpet density and carpet face weight are not … Web1 mei 2011 · This article presents a complete treatment of a class of RAID-6 codes, called minimum density RAID-6 codes, that have an optimal blend of performance properties. There are two families of minimal density RAID-6 codes: Blaum-Roth codes and Liberation codes, and a separate special-purpose code called the Liber8tion code.

WebMinimum Density Adjustments for Moderate Slopes (CMC 18.30.100): Residential developments in the R-4, R-6 and R-8 zones may modify the minimum density factor … Webhas a minimum density factor of 83%, less 1.5% for each 1% of average slope in excess of 5%. Since 11% is 6% above 5%, multiply 6 times 1.5 which would equal 9%. Subtract …

Web1 jun. 2024 · MDD is the density that is achieved in the laboratory at the optimum moisture content (OMC). It is the maximum density you can achieve for given conditions. So, quality control officers use this as a threshold value to determine if the pavement or earthwork is of good quality or not. Also Read: Difference between compaction and consolidation
